Transaction f977fe76020ce276cd4014e7935a75426bca010a91a8de6cb21cb777a60ce581

101 Input
2 Outputs
  • f977fe76020ce276cd4014e7935a75426bca010a91a8de6cb21cb777a60ce581:0
  • value  817000000
    address  338u4bD9tmLFfAxHrEZLsNEnzHP6CgagYD
  • f977fe76020ce276cd4014e7935a75426bca010a91a8de6cb21cb777a60ce581:1
  • value  1724155
    address  3HduDfeAj5QeLrnuCv1UHQyAHRyR2Lze2Q